How does it work?
RSS (Really Simple Syndication) is a method that allows you to seamlessly receive updates from websites and blogs that you follow. RSS feeds work like a specific subscription. You subscribe to important content and get it directly into your program for reading RSS feeds – also known as an RSS reader.

What programs do you need to view RSS feeds?
To start taking advantage of RSS feeds, you need to choose and install an RSS reading app. Here are a few popular options:

Feedly – one of the most widely used RSS readers with a simple interface and support for many devices. It allows you to conveniently set up your subscriptions.

Inoreader – another convenient tool for reading RSS feeds, offering many features for experienced users, such as filters and categorization.

The Old Reader – a reader that is similar to the old version of Google Reader. It’s perfect for those who value simplicity and modesty.

Netvibes – this platform lets you to create a personalized homepage with RSS subscriptions, widgets, and other modules.

Additionally, there are smartphone apps for reading RSS feeds, such as Reeder for iOS or gReader for Android.

How to set up an RSS feed?
Setting up an RSS feed is straightforward:

Choose an RSS reader that suits your needs in terms of capabilities.

Add feeds: find the RSS link on the website (it’s usually an orange icon with white waves), click on it, copy the URL, and paste it into your reader.

Organize feeds: divide them into categories to easily find the content you need.

Set up notifications: if you want to quickly know about fresh posts, set up notifications or auto-update.
